‘Marijuana Martinis’ by Liv Hamrick is the most popular of the three written by her. It is a guide to cannabis for women. She has extensively mentioned how to use cannabis in a proper way. She herself started using the herb shortly after her surgeries to ease the pain. Since then, she has been an advocate of the herb and its benefits. As people tend to view cannabis in a negative light, this is a much-needed book so that people know its benefits too. She started the book by introducing cannabis and its history and dug deeper, and discussed other various topics like the benefits, problems, stigma around it, etc.

I like that the author discussed various strains and their usage. The best part for me was when she gave recipes. The recipes included a range of items from drinks to baking items. Also, this book mentions the drawbacks of the herb, which gives a good balance to the entire theme.

I could not find anything to dislike about this book because its contents were well thought out. This book gives great insight into the entire topic of cannabis. Liv has arranged the book in a very systematic manner, which makes it an exceptional read.

I would rate this book 5 out of 5 stars for the reasons mentioned above. This book can help women who are interested in trying the herb but do not have a reliable source for the same. Liv has boldly dealt with a widely stigmatised issue. She has used concise words to tell one everything they need to know. I only found one error, so I'd say the book was well-edited. I would recommend this book to not only those who are new to cannabis but also to its existing users and to those who want to just know what the fuss is about.
